{"schemaVersion":1,"recordType":"legal-article","id":"law:eri:code:civil:2015:article:313","workId":"law:eri:code:civil:2015","expressionId":"law:eri:code:civil:2015:en","title":"Approval of Accounts","number":"313","language":"en","canonicalUrl":"https://eriatlas.com/law/civil-code-2015/article/313/","hierarchy":{"book":"BOOK I - PERSONS","title":"TITLE II. - CAPACITY OF PERSONS.","chapter":"Chapter 2. - Minors","section":"Section 5. - Cessation of the Disability of the Minor","paragraph":"Paragraph 2. - Rendering of Accounts of Guardianship"},"paragraphs":[{"id":"p1","number":"1","text":"The approval of the accounts of the guardianship given by the ward may be revoked by him within one year after it has taken place, so long as the ward has not attained the age of eighteen years.","canonicalUrl":"https://eriatlas.com/law/civil-code-2015/article/313/#p1","sourceTargets":[{"sourceId":"civil-code-2015-en","pdfPage":94,"url":"https://eriatlas.com/sources/civil-code-2015/page/94/?article=313&paragraph=p1#article-313-p1"}]},{"id":"p2","number":"2","text":"The same shall apply to the exemption from rendering accounts granted by the ward to the guardian.","canonicalUrl":"https://eriatlas.com/law/civil-code-2015/article/313/#p2","sourceTargets":[{"sourceId":"civil-code-2015-en","pdfPage":95,"url":"https://eriatlas.com/sources/civil-code-2015/page/95/?article=313&paragraph=p2#article-313-p2"}]},{"id":"p3","number":"3","text":"The provisions of sub-Articles (1) and (2) may not be invoked by the heirs of the minor who have attained majority when they themselves have approved the accounts of the guardian or exempted the guardian from rendering accounts.","canonicalUrl":"https://eriatlas.com/law/civil-code-2015/article/313/#p3","sourceTargets":[{"sourceId":"civil-code-2015-en","pdfPage":95,"url":"https://eriatlas.com/sources/civil-code-2015/page/95/?article=313&paragraph=p3#article-313-p3"}]}],"caution":"This is the 2015 English-language edition attributed in its front matter to the Ministry of Justice.
